The expected outcomes of this project include: (1) enhanced Bangladesh labour laws aligns more with international labour standards and the application of laws; (2) labour administration institutions are more functional, transparent, and effective in line with International Labour Standards (ILS) and good governance; (3) social dialogue platforms and mechanisms are effective, gender-responsive, and inclusive; (4) supported enterprises become more gender-responsive, inclusive, safe, sustainable, competitive and supportive of decent work integration and promotion; (5) child labour, especially hazardous forms, is reduced; and (6) employment injury benefits are extended to workers. This includes women workers and families of workers in the ready-made garments (RMG) and other sectors to compensate for disabilities or deaths arising out of work-related accidents, injuries, and occupational diseases.
